MSC2966 defines how Matrix clients show use dynamic client registration.
The contacts
field is required but missing from EIX. Note that the RFC7591 doesn't make it mandatory which might be causing some confusion.
Simple fix is to add a value like ["[email protected]"]
which can be overridden like the other OIDC registration values.